Applications
Amyl Nitrite, CAS 110-46-3, is primarily used as an intermediate in the synthesis of nitrite esters and related compounds, serving as a source of alkyl nitrite for esterification and nitrosation reactions to form other nitrite derivatives. It is also used as a solvent or reaction medium in specialized chemical processes and is a precursor to other alkyl nitrite derivatives. In industrial sectors such as coatings/inks and polymers, amyl nitrite may be employed as a nitrite-ester related component to tailor formulation properties. Additionally, it may be explored in fragrance chemistry as a potential odorant in research contexts, with use subject to local regulations and formulation limits.
